Создание автоматического поезда в Роблокс Студио — обширное руководство для начинающих

В наши дни Роблокс является одной из самых популярных платформ для создания и игры в виртуальные миры. Одной из самых увлекательных и интересных задач для разработчиков в Роблокс является создание автоматического поезда.

Автоматический поезд - это объект, который движется по предопределенному маршруту без участия игрока. Он может быть использован в различных жанрах игр, начиная от поезда-симуляторов и заканчивая платформерами и квестами.

В этом руководстве для начинающих мы покажем вам, как создать автоматический поезд при помощи Роблокс Студио. Мы расскажем о необходимых инструментах и настройках, а также приведем примеры кода, которые вы можете использовать в своих проектах.

Будьте готовы к увлекательному и творческому процессу создания автоматического поезда в Роблокс Студио. Раскройте свой потенциал и создайте уникальный и захватывающий игровой опыт для своих игроков!

Установка и настройка Роблокс Студио

Установка и настройка Роблокс Студио
  1. Перейдите на официальный сайт Роблокс по адресу www.roblox.com
  2. Нажмите на кнопку "Зарегистрироваться" и создайте новый аккаунт, если еще не зарегистрированы
  3. После регистрации и входа на сайт, найдите и нажмите на кнопку "Создать"
  4. В открывшемся меню выберите "Создать игру" или "Редактировать" для редактирования уже имеющейся игры
  5. Скачайте и установите Роблокс Студио на ваш компьютер

После успешной установки вы можете запустить Роблокс Студио, используя ярлык на рабочем столе, или через меню "Пуск". Перед вами откроется приятный и интуитивно понятный интерфейс Роблокс Студио.

Перед началом работы рекомендуется настроить несколько параметров для оптимального использования Роблокс Студио:

  • Перейдите в "Настройки" с помощью меню "Файл" и выберите нужные вам параметры
  • Настройте наиболее подходящий режим работы, учитывая ваши предпочтения и характеристики компьютера
  • При необходимости, в "Настройках" можно настроить горячие клавиши, интерфейс и другие параметры

После установки и настройки Роблокс Студио вы будете готовы к созданию своего первого автоматического поезда и воплощению своих идей в игровом мире Роблокса!

Создание основных компонентов поезда

Создание основных компонентов поезда

Прежде чем начать создание автоматического поезда, нам необходимо создать основные компоненты, которые он будет использовать.

1. Подкатковая платформа: это основная платформа, на которую будут устанавливаться все остальные компоненты. Она представляет собой длинный прямоугольный блок, который будет двигаться по рельсам.

2. Поддоны: это платформы, на которые будут устанавливаться вагоны поезда. Они должны быть достаточно широкими, чтобы в них мог поместиться весь поезд.

3. Вагоны: каждый вагон представляет собой отдельный блок, на который можно ставить объекты, такие как сиденья или окна. Их можно создать в любом количестве в соответствии с нуждами проекта.

4. Двигатель: это компонент, который будет отвечать за передвижение поезда. Он должен быть достаточно мощным, чтобы тянуть все вагоны и не останавливаться на подъемах.

5. Кабина управления: это место, откуда можно будет контролировать движение поезда. Она должна быть оборудована всеми необходимыми элементами управления, такими как ручка газа и руль.

Важно: При создании основных компонентов поезда, обязательно учтите их размеры и соответствие друг другу. Это поможет реализовать более реалистичное и безопасное движение вашего автоматического поезда.

Теперь, когда у нас есть понимание основных компонентов поезда, мы можем приступить к их созданию в Роблокс Студио и настройке их функционала.

Добавление автоматического движения и управления

Добавление автоматического движения и управления

В этом разделе мы рассмотрим, как добавить автоматическое движение и управление в ваш автоматический поезд в Роблокс Студио.

  1. Во-первых, создайте новую переменную с именем "speed" и установите ее значение на скорость, с которой вы хотите, чтобы ваш поезд двигался.
  2. Затем добавьте новый скрипт к вашему объекту поезда. В этом скрипте мы будем использовать функцию "MovePosition" для движения объекта поезда.
  3. Введите следующий код в свой скрипт:

    local train = script.Parent

    local speed = 20

    function moveTrain()

    `train:MovePosition(train.Position + (train.Forward * speed))`

    end

    game:GetService("RunService").Heartbeat:Connect(moveTrain)

  4. Обратите внимание, что мы используем переменную "speed", чтобы определить скорость движения поезда. Вы можете настроить ее значение в начале скрипта, чтобы получить желаемую скорость движения.
  5. Теперь добавьте управление поездом. Для этого добавьте новый скрипт к вашей модели поезда.
  6. Введите следующий код в свой скрипт:

    local train = script.Parent

    function onKeyPressed(player, keyPressed)

    if keyPressed.KeyCode == Enum.KeyCode.W then

    `train:SetPrimaryPartCFrame(train.PrimaryPart.CFrame + (train.PrimaryPart.CFrame.LookVector * 5))`

    end

    end

    game:GetService("UserInputService").KeyPressed:Connect(onKeyPressed)

  7. В этом коде мы использовали функцию "SetPrimaryPartCFrame" для управления движением поезда вперед при нажатии клавиши "W". Вы можете изменить это сочетание клавиш или написать другой код для управления движением поезда влево, вправо и назад.
  8. Теперь ваш автоматический поезд будет двигаться вперед со скоростью, указанной в переменной "speed", и вы сможете управлять им с помощью указанных комбинаций клавиш.

Ура! Теперь вы знаете, как добавить автоматическое движение и управление в ваш автоматический поезд в Роблокс Студио. Наслаждайтесь своими проектами и удачи в программировании!

Оцените статью